Description

Vichy Minéral 89 72H Moisture Boosting Cream 40 ml is formulated to intensely hydrate the skin while strengthening its protective barrier.

Thanks to OSMOSKIN technology combined with pure hyaluronic acid, minerals, vitamins B3 and E, and squalane, this treatment helps to regenerate and protect the skin durably.
Suitable for all skin types, including sensitive skin, its formula provides reinforced hydration for up to 72 hours while leaving the skin softer, more supple, and comfortable.
After application, the skin appears visibly more nourished and better protected against dehydration.
This cream with its light and fresh texture offers pleasant daily comfort, without a heavy effect on the skin.
Non-comedogenic.

Dermatologically tested.

Made in France.
